#e42048 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e42048 is composed of 89.4% red, 12.5%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 86% magenta, 68.4%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 347.8 degrees, a saturation of 78.4% and a lightness of 51%. #e42048 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ff4090 with #c90000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3333.

Shades and Tints of #e42048

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040101 is the darkest color, while #fdf2f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e42048

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#848081 is the less saturated color, while #f70d3d is the most saturated one.
